NCAA Division 1 swimming recruiting rules permit college coaches to recruit at any time except during four-day Dead Period, November 710, 2022. On August 1 before junior year, NCAA swimming recruiting rules permit student-athletes and their families to take an official visit. This means that recruiting efforts really ramp up during your junior year. Terms of Use & Privacy Policy | FTC Disclaimer The 2021 NCAA Women's Swimming & Diving Championships will take place from March 17-20 in Greensboro, North Carolina at the Greensboro Aquatic Center. Division 1 swim teams are allotted the equivalent of 14 scholarships, and each program can use the money differently. The best way that swimmers can improve their odds of getting a scholarship is to look for programs where they can contribute points to the team.
